Output d3f6d608145feffd8e0815cbe4429349ade67c8a0ca4e482f252b35c87f8fb8b:0

value
2647642
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c92645dde9a940c376337bafa4c12b6ecf8c0210 OP_EQUAL
address
3L2bbMHdLq9bpBAvpDWe9FVDUpcJEnWAi9
transaction
d3f6d608145feffd8e0815cbe4429349ade67c8a0ca4e482f252b35c87f8fb8b
confirmations
437411
spent
true